Transaction 95e0d8e33ca84b89bd061fc23dfd4620d63f0530074744f61d5a398275b1d2c5

2 Input
2 Outputs
  • 95e0d8e33ca84b89bd061fc23dfd4620d63f0530074744f61d5a398275b1d2c5:0
  • value  1407300
    address  3PpyHkSztfbFdFjdKQpRaRDrFvnq9k2UGW
  • 95e0d8e33ca84b89bd061fc23dfd4620d63f0530074744f61d5a398275b1d2c5:1
  • value  1206553
    address  3DGPXTEB7dMtcWQ6LRkLktsp54MrzDGWCT